Animal control is a service in The Sims: Unleashed that can be called over the phone when Henri LeStanc or El Bandito appear on the lot. After being called, Animal Control Evan will come by shortly afterwards to capture the pest; build and buy mode will be disabled during this time. Once the animal is captured, the household will be charged and he will leave. Animal control also reappears in The Sims 2: Pets, but their role is completely different, instead behaving similarly to social workers taking away pets if their needs drop too low, if they are left home alone, or if there are no more older Sims remaining in the household (i.e. due to death). They also will come to deliver adopted pets to their new owners.
